Cruise with Nickelodeon aboard even more Norwegian ships When you're looking for a family vacation, you want to have the option to participate in activities and events that everyone can enjoy together. With Nickelodeon, exclusively on Norwegian Cruise Line, there are activities for the whole family to enjoy together. And now, we're thrilled to announce that beginning February 2012 we are expanding Nickelodeon's presence to Norwegian Gem. So whether it's the Caribbean during Spring Break or the Holidays, or Alaska or Europe in the summer, your family will be able to enjoy Nickelodeon aboard Norwegian. It's the ideal vacation where parents relax, kids play and families connect. Year-round, Norwegian ships that feature Nickelodeon events and activities will offer families the opportunity to: Compete in Nickelodeon's signature messy game show - Slime Time LIVE! Play interactive games by the pool during Nick Live Poolside! Dance and sing during Dora's Music Party. Hang out and eat with SpongeBob SquarePants, Dora the Explorer and more during the Breakfast with Nickelodeon*. Or choose from the additional activities specifically designed to encourage your family to explore, play and imagine together. * Breakfast with Nickelodeon available for a nominal fee. Posted October 27, 2011 Author #3 Share Posted October 27, 2011 for those that sail on these NICK ships, does this mean that the ships will generally have more kids onboard and does it mean less regular cruise activity during the day? I haven't noticed any less regular cruise activities, but there seemed to be more younger children on the JEWEL than the GEM when they were sailing the same itinerary a day apart out of NY. I also seemed to notice more family's who kept the younger kids out of the kids club afternoons when the NICK activities typically take place. The kids and the NICK activities never affected my cruise at all, so it wouldn't stop me from booking a cruise with NICK on board.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

CruisinMaterial Posted October 28, 2011 #11 Share Posted October 28, 2011 I don't mind the Nickelodeon presence on the NORWEGIAN EPIC because the ship is so big that the activities are not as intrusive - especially since the EPIC has SPICE H2O, a complex designed to get away from children. However, when Nickelodeon came onboard the Norwegian Jewel - a ship I once regarded as the best in the NCL fleet overall - my opinion of that ship changed. I sailed on the Jewel in January and the changes were aplenty on the 10 day voyage. First and foremost, in favor of a Nickelodeon's SLIME TIME LIVE a production show was eliminated (Country Gold). Now granted Country Gold was the least liked of the three productions on the NCL Jewel, it was still a production show for the adults to enjoy. They needed the space for the Nick stuff in the theater storage area. During the sea days in what is already a single pool area each afternoon there would be a Nickelodeon presentation of some sort at the pool. Now the pool games are fine in general but to have kids running around everywhere during the Nick stuff is just not my cup of tea. :cool: I hope NCL contains this Nickelodeon crap to the Jewel, Gem and Epic and keeps it FAR away from the remainder of their fleet. I've never sailed the Gem and I guess I will be much less likely to now.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
